FL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2024 in Review

293 of the 6,942 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Foot Locker (FL) for Q1 2024, worth a combined $2.72B — down 14% from $3.17B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 61 funds opened new FL positions and 47 closed out — a net gain of 14 holders — while 90 added to existing stakes and 88 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Dimensional Fund Advisors, adding an estimated $44.7M. The largest seller was BlackRock, cutting an estimated $87.6M.
